Consume the Google OAuth callback.
Always redirects to the configured frontend URL — successfully
with a session cookie set, or with ?error=oauth_failed on
any verification / exchange / userinfo failure (the specific
reason lands in structured logs, not in the redirect URL).
Documentation Index
Fetch the complete documentation index at: https://docs.roughy.ai/llms.txt
Use this file to discover all available pages before exploring further.